RecBCD◦ Helicase activity unwinds
DNA◦ Exonuclease activity
degrades both single strands◦ At CHI site
3′ - 5′ Exonuclease activity is inhibited
5′ -3′ activity enhanced yielding a single-stranded 3′ end. This end becomes coated
with multiple RecA proteins, which catalyze strand invasion and formation of a Holliday structure

RecA◦ RecA binds ssDNA in the presence of ATP◦ RecA aligns the ssDNA with its
homologous dsDNA region◦ RecA inserts the ssDNA into target DNA
sequence forming a heteroduplex Holiday-type structure
